MEDICLIN Aktiengesellschaft, trading under the ticker MED with WKN 659 510, has announced it will host a virtual press conference on Friday, 27 March 2026 at 11:00 am Central European Time. The event will focus on the company's financial statements for the 2025 fiscal year. The Management Board will deliver a presentation covering the 2025 financial results, current developments within the company, and the outlook for 2026.
The presentation will be conducted in German via webcast. Following the formal presentation, participants will have the opportunity to ask questions during a Q&A session. To actively participate and pose questions, attendees must dial in by telephone, as the webcast audio feed through an internet browser does not support interactive participation. Participants are advised to dial in 10 minutes before the event begins. A replay of the webcast, excluding the Q&A portion, will be made available on the MEDICLIN website shortly after the conference concludes.
MEDICLIN AG is a significant player in Germany's healthcare landscape, specializing primarily in medical rehabilitation. The company operates a network of 31 clinics, six long-term care facilities, and ten medical care centers across the country, employing approximately 9,900 staff members. Its integrated care model coordinates services from initial consultation and surgery through to rehabilitation and outpatient follow-up, with medical, therapeutic, and nursing teams working closely together to tailor support to individual patient needs. MEDICLIN is part of the ASKLEPIOS Group.
